Вопрос

Я пишу простое приложение, которое предлагает пользователям их полное имя, адрес электронной почты и контактную информацию.Затем используется эта информация для генерации HTML-кода для их корпоративной подписи, гарантируя, что все подписи универсальны в формате и макете.

Что я хочу сделать, это автоматически добавить эту подпись на Outlook после того, как она будет сгенерирована.Это возможно и как бы я пошел об этом?

Спасибо

Джонни

Это было полезно?

Решение

для Windows 7 и Outlook 2010, подписи пользователя хранятся в виде текстовых файлов под

C:\Users\xxxx\AppData\Roaming\Microsoft\Signatures\
.

или

%APPDATA%\Microsoft\Signatures\
.

Ваш инструмент может создавать такие файлы и хранить их в каталоге подписей . Убедитесь, что вы создаете файлы подписи в трех ароматах: 1. Формат текста, 2. Формат HTML, 3. RTF.В противном случае пользователь не будет иметь подпись для всех параметров формата почты.

Помимо предоставления файлов подписи, необходимы дополнительные настройки реестра для фактического использования подписей для новых рассылков или для ответов.Рецепт Microsoft Здесь .

Убедитесь, что отключение сигнатур групповой политики не активен.

Лицензировано под: CC-BY-SA с атрибуция
Не связан с StackOverflow
scroll top